Transaction 6602a8fd6ee1687539c7e208808e4c8aaf20fc7ac467dfd9e7e6841f53e3c79a

2 Input
2 Outputs
  • 6602a8fd6ee1687539c7e208808e4c8aaf20fc7ac467dfd9e7e6841f53e3c79a:0
  • value  94627
    address  13qQmmQ9MQuVkuAZhfvDU1sNyhgsmuQ5da
  • 6602a8fd6ee1687539c7e208808e4c8aaf20fc7ac467dfd9e7e6841f53e3c79a:1
  • value  1395234
    address  3NHYqT6RGqyyhtcnmSgt9TKubjCYZVPpD1